In Qingzhou Quyang County, Xiangshou Mountain Marketplace faced a raid, destroyed instantaneously, and the Foundation Establishnt Sect Ziluo Mountain was robbed, its riches plundered completely, the mountain gate burned to white ashes, and three hundred and fifty years of effort vanished overnight.

This explosive news rapidly spread throughout Quyang County and quickly disseminated to surrounding County Mansions.

It is said that when Sect Leader Zhuo Wuying returned to the mountain gate and saw the bleak, thoroughly clean scene, this Foundation Establishnt Feather Scholar actually cried out on the spot, vomited blood, experienced chaotic spiritual power, and fainted.

This news was also reported to Qingling Sect in Quyang County. Their subordinate sect suffered such a calamity, stirring the managent of this major sect into action, beginning to search for traces of these bandits in the county.

However, Lu Qian had already led his group out of Quyang County by then. They quickly maneuvered, bypassing major sects and marketplaces, charting a wavy line from Qingzhou back to the borders of Cangzhou.

They successfully t up with Chen Wei and the Sky Ray waiting there, boarded the Sky Ray, and flew directly to Chongming County, finally breathing a sigh of relief.

On the Sky Ray’s back, Lu Qian set up an array and initiated a simple post-war summary eting. Everyone’s eyes were ablaze, looking at Lu Qian, for they all knew that the ti for rewards had arrived.

According to Yunshan Sect’s regulations, all war spoils organized by the sect must be publicly surrendered, and rits discussed after the war to allocate rewards.

To ensure disciples truthfully surrendered their gains, not only were severe disciplinary asures written in the sect’s rules, but it was also stipulated during operations that all spoils must not be stored in private storage pouches. They must be directly loaded into designated public storage pouches under everyone’s watch and promptly handed over after the battle.

The public storage pouch was managed by the team leader, and all spoils were imdiately sealed with a special talisman after collection, not to be opened. Post-war, the talisman’s integrity is inspected.

During this process, all disciples oversee each other, strictly prohibiting private appropriation.

Even this way, private appropriation may still occur. But Lu Qian temporarily has no better solution and can only go so far.

After the war spoils were collected, it ca ti for the eagerly anticipated rit accounting and rewards.

However, this situation was slightly different as Lu Qian had gathered eighteen Late-Stage Qi Cultivation and twenty Mid-Stage Qi Cultivation individuals from Shuangye Alliance families, necessitating a portion of the war spoils to be given as remuneration based on each family’s contributions.

The usual practice would be to send the gratitude to the sect from which the borrowed personnel ca, then the participating cultivators’ share would be allocated by the relevant sect itself.

But the cultivators accomplished significant feats this ti, intimidating Bailu Mountain for territory, guarding Lu Qian successfully to Foundation Establishnt, invading Xiangshou Mountain Marketplace, breaching Ziluo Mountain’s mountain gate, with gains surpassing those from the previous Chaosheng Sect annihilation!

As for how much was gained specifically, it still needs to wait until returning to the mountain, where Internal Affairs Elder Jiang Qingfeng will oversee the tallying and inventory work.

The sole deficit of this grand victory was during the final attack on Ziluo Mountain, where Ziluo Mountain disciples’ desperate counterattack resulted in five Shuangye Alliance cultivators being killed in battle.

Massacre, sect annihilation, life-and-death combat, deaths are perfectly normal. Even as Lu Qian tried his best to maintain advantage, accidents would still happen.

He is thankful inside that Yunshan disciples, under the extra care from two Foundation Establishnt mbers, were all intact with no significant losses, with only a few injuries. This was sufficient.

Lu Qian first affird the contributions of Shuangye Alliance cultivators in this surprise attack, announcing the rit accounting status and specifically highlighting several cultivators’ excellent performances. These individuals all flushed red, beaming with excitent.

Everyone felt Lu Qian’s praises were sincere and felt quite valued, all puffing up their chests in pride and shared glory.

Subsequently, Lu Qian expressed that beyond providing the corresponding sect remuneration, he would additionally gift these cultivators a red envelope each, further exciting the crowd, prompting cheers.

Finally, Lu Qian promised generous consolation to the bereaved families of fallen cultivators, earning high praise from everyone.

Xuu Yingcai and Chen Wei, unsurprisingly, felt powerless and resigned. Even Zhao Xianzong sighed inwardly; having such events repeatedly is likely to have these cultivators etching Yunshan Sect as their Alliance leader and Sect Leader in mind, forgetting their original sect.

Subsequently, Shuangye Alliance cultivators left the array, and Yunshan Sect disciples continued the eting.

Approaching Bichao Mountain, both the original disciples and those returning after three years of separation were deeply thrilled at heart.

Especially the latter.

Just upon returning to the sect, Lu Qian led them to a grand victory.

Easy win, spectacular win, morale-boosting win!

The Wang Family and Ziluo Mountain that previously chased them across the county, under Lu Qian’s sche this ti, not only lost Xiangshou Mountain Marketplace but even Ziluo Mountain’s mountain gate was burned to ashes.

A real relief! A huge relief!

Recalling the raging fire, their hearts still feel utterly exhilarating and extrely delighted.

Junior Brother Hao and others discussed privately, sharing the sentint that Lu Qian as Sect Leader, whether in cultivation level or martial arts, interpersonal skills or strategic acun, far exceeded Yang Jiye by several tis, earning their deep admiration.

Yang Jiye, Wang Yu, and others also, while feeling vindicated, sincerely recognized Lu Qian’s capabilities.

Through this battle, these previously dispersed disciples truly returned loyalty-wise, now all eagerly looking forward to returning to Bichao Mountain.

For Yunshan disciples, Lu Qian rely comnded and encouraged them; as for rewards, naturally, they will be distributed upon returning to the mountain gate, based on sect regulations and reward systems.

Over these past three years, Yunshan disciples have beco accustod to this process, knowing the sect is strict on rewards and punishnts, naturally indifferent. Returning disciples, though a bit puzzled, now fully trust Lu Qian and therefore do not worry, planning to inquire with their nephews after the eting disperses.

In the end, Yunshan disciples also left first, leaving only Yang Jiye, Tan Hong, Wang Yu, and Zheng Duan in the array.

After recent engagents, Lu Qian noticed Senior Brother Wang Yu, of Qi Cultivation tenth level, was amiable, mature, and prudent, with detailed and comprehensive planning skills, also capable of independently taking charge.

Additionally, among the dispersed disciples, he was quite esteed, so after returning to the mountain this ti, aside from Yang Jiye being appointed as Elder, Lu Qian intended to also appoint Wang Yu as Elder of Yunshan Sect.

Thus, in this temporary managent eting, Lu Qian invited Wang Yu too.

The topic of this eting, in fact, was about how to settle the returning disciples aside from Yang Jiye and Wang Yu, or rather, what treatnt to offer them.

Knowing that this group of dispersed disciples are all fourth-generation disciples of Yunshan Sect with the sa rank as Lu Qian, including nine who are Lu Qian’s senior brothers and two junior brothers.

Such rank here implicates the impossibility of casual handling.

Yang Jiye and Wang Yu, as the leaders of this traveling group, naturally knew team mbers well, while Tan Hong and Zheng Duan, after these days of interaction, also ford a relatively concrete impression.

Thus, Lu Qian planned to hear their opinions.
